Responsibilities

Join an existing team with a growing product vision and get involved in all aspects of design, delivery, and support of systems.
Add features to the product continuously and iteratively, emphasizing collaboration with technical and non-technical counterparts.
Collaborate with engineering, design, product, and platform teams to develop, build, run, and support the system.
Finesse around legacy codebases, particularly with regards to extension and maintenance, with an eye for technical quality improvement.
Troubleshoot ETL pipelines, support legacy systems, and respond to incidents.

Required

Hands-on Python Development Experience – Well-constructed, intelligently tested, easy to re-use and extendable packages.
Developing REST APIs using Python frameworks (preferably Flask).
Publishing Python packages, maintaining them, and building Python CLI tools.
Deploying REST APIs in containerized environments (Docker swarm, Kubernetes, etc.). Working with other developers in the team to integrate those APIs with our web applications.
Working with services from one of the major Cloud providers – Preferably AWS Services such as S3, Secrets Manager, SQS (Simple Queue Service), EKS, etc.
Writing CI/CD pipelines -- Azure DevOps and/or GitLab preferred.
SQL, MongoDB, and/or Snowflake using Python.
Designing data models for effective data storage and retrieval (preferably SQL, MongoDB, Snowflake).
Supporting legacy systems and responding to incidents.
Troubleshooting ETL pipelines.

Preferred

Writing CI/CD configuration (preferably GitLab).
Configuring observability and alerting services (preferably Datadog and Opsgenie).
Writing infrastructure as code (preferably Terraform).
Integrating managed authentication services (preferably Auth0).
Hands-on experience in designing, developing and deploying RESTful APIs and understanding of micro-services.
You will have worked on at least one API that successfully met the acceptance tests of product stakeholders and delivered business value to your enterprise.
Experience building docker images and deploying services and container-based applications with Docker swarm/Kubernetes.
Understanding of Distributed and Event based systems (Kafka, SQS).
C# experience.

Company

KBRA was established in 2010 in an effort to restore trust in credit ratings by creating new standards for assessing risk and by offering accurate and transparent ratings.
